FlowCut™ cutting system generates upward airflow that lifts wet or flattened grass upright, ensuring every blade of grass is cut for a cleaner, more complete cut.

The industry's first dual‑layer blades combine with a high‑velocity fan to generate a cyclonic airflow that recirculates and shreds clippings into tiny particles that vanish back into the turf.

The nutrient-rich, micro-fine mulch clippings are returned evenly across the soil to support a smoother, healthier lawn from the roots up.

TRON SE climbs slobes up to 65% (33°) without losing traction. The elevated chassis and dual hub motors keeps it moving smoothly over rough ground, roots, and ruts where other mowers stall.

Twelve-segment front wheels, with a 30° tilt, and full‑directional steering delivers damage‑free maneuverability. TRON SE pivots cleanly in tight spaces and glides on turf and effortlessly to avoid skid marks, torn-up turf or getting stuck.
Four large wheels give TRON SE improved traction and off‑roading stability, climbing slopes, crossing ruts, and powering through uneven turf with ease.
Omni‑chassis system, and dual suspensions, adapts to terrain changes in real time, keeping TRON SE level, stable, and on course no matter what the terrain may throw at it.

Network RTK and 140° omni‑vision work together to deliver inch‑level accuracy in any scenario, including tight corners, narrow paths, and under-tree zones.
140° AI Obstacle Detection & Avoidance
Set up to 80 zones for different grass types and slopes. Customize schedules and cutting heights for precise, tailored mowing. Ideal for lawns with mixed grass types, separate areas, or different maintenance needs.
The AIRSEEKERS App lets you customize mowing height, direction, and schedules for different zones. From tidy gardens to taller orchard grass, TRON SE adapts intelligently for precise, personalized lawn care.
When the battery runs low or rain is detected, TRON automatically returns to its charging dock.

Please read the safety manual before installation. Place the charging station on a flat, open surface with at least a 2×2 meter obstacle-free area in front. Avoid areas prone to flooding or heavy foot traffic. The RTK base station can share a power source with the charging station or be installed independently in an open area for optimal signal coverage. After assembly and power connection, place Tron in the charging station. When the indicator turns green and the front and rear lights show flowing green lights, it indicates charging. Once fully charged, the lights will stay solid green.
After powering on TRON, enable Bluetooth and connect to Wi-Fi on your phone. Open the app and scan the QR code on the device to pair. First-time pairing also requires scanning the RTK QR code. During pairing, a blue light will flash. A successful connection is confirmed with a sound and normal lighting.
Please check the following: Is the battery charged and properly installed? Is the power switch on? Are there any error messages or warning lights? Is the blade disc jammed? Are the safety sensors functioning properly? If all checks are fine, try resetting the device. If it still won’t start, contact after-sales support.
This may be due to: 1) The robot is outside its working zone or path. Please adjust its position. 2) The RTK signal is weak due to distance or obstructions. Check the signal and move the robot to an open area if needed. 3) The path is blocked. Clear any obstacles from the route.
